AGI Awards for Excellence to be Announced at GEO Business

London, 23 April 2024 – The Association for Geographic Information (AGI), the membership group for organisations and individuals working in the geospatial sector, will present its Awards for Excellence at the UK’s largest geospatial event GEO Business. Working with event organisers Diversified Communications, the Association will also have a significant presence on the show floor, which it will use to make announcements about new AGI Networks, forthcoming surveys and research activities, and outreach events.

“GEO Business is a significant event in the UK geospatial calendar and we are once again thrilled to offer our support and be part of the packed programme of live demos, interactive sessions and CPD accredited learning opportunities,” commented Fergus Craig, Co-Chair of the Association for Geographic Information.

“GEO Business was the obvious platform for us to present the winners of the much-anticipated AGI Awards for Excellence, relaunched this year after a ten-year break and we are delighted to announce that some of the judges and supporters of the Awards will join us on stage to present the winners with their accolades.” 

Submissions for the AGI Awards were encouraged from organisations and individuals, working in or with geospatial, who want to showcase innovation, achievements and best practice. Categories are the ‘Chairperson’s Award for Outstanding Service to the Geospatial Community’, ‘Geospatial Professional of the Year’, ‘Early Career Professional’, ‘Excellence with Impact’, ‘Environment and Sustainability’ and ‘Ethics and Responsible Use’. The winners will be announced at a ceremony on the 5th June 2024 at ExCel London.

“We are pleased to once again be working with the AGI again in the run up to this years’ event,” added Oliver Hughes, Portfolio Director at Diversified Communications, organisers of GEO Business 24. “Their support, and that of their members is integral to the events success, and we are excited to host their awards presentation.”  

GEO Business is a two-day event which takes place at ExCel London on the 5-6th June 2024. Attracting over 3,500 professionals who will discover and debate the latest technical advancements and best practice in the geospatial sector, GEO Business features an exhibition of over 120 leading brands and start-ups and an education programme made up of 120 plus sessions, across 6 theatres, covering new trends, informative case studies and pressing industry issues.
